The Global Facial Mist Market is projected to expand from USD 857.99 Million in 2025 to USD 1.29 billion by 2031, registering a CAGR of 7.04%. Defined as aqueous skincare products fortified with botanical extracts and humectants, these mists are engineered to deliver immediate revitalization and hydration through a fine spray application. The primary growth catalysts include rising consumer demand for portable moisture solutions and formulations capable of shielding the skin barrier from environmental pollutants. This strong market interest mirrors the broader sector's vitality; according to the Cosmetic, Toiletry and Perfumery Association, skincare sales in the Great Britain market rose by 12.2% in 2024, with growth largely fueled by prestige and healthcare-focused offerings.

However, market expansion faces a substantial hurdle due to the classification of facial mists as non-essential, discretionary goods, which induces high price sensitivity during times of financial tightness. Unlike fundamental necessities such as cleansers or moisturizers, consumers often remove mists from their regimens when disposable income shrinks. Furthermore, the sector is encountering increasing scrutiny regarding sustainability, specifically related to the environmental footprint of aerosol propellants and single-use plastic packaging, thereby compelling manufacturers to commit to expensive eco-friendly alternatives to secure long-term operational viability.

Market Drivers

The influence of digital marketing and social media personalities serves as a primary driver reshaping the Global Facial Mist Market. Platforms such as Instagram and TikTok have elevated mists from optional add-ons to viral necessities, popularized by trends like "glass skin" that highlight products for their instant setting and illuminating effects. Brands that successfully leverage this digital-first strategy are securing substantial engagement from younger consumers who value visible outcomes. For example, e.l.f. Beauty reported a net sales surge of 77% in its 'Fiscal 2024 Results' released in May 2024, a performance attributed to enhancing brand relevance via digital channels, demonstrating how influencer-driven narratives directly quicken the commercial success of functional cosmetics.

Concurrently, heightened awareness regarding anti-aging benefits and skin hydration is urging consumers to seek formulations backed by clinical efficacy. Modern buyers increasingly require mists infused with dermatological ingredients, such as hyaluronic acid and thermal water, to repair the skin barrier rather than providing mere refreshment. This transition is propelling the expansion of science-based skincare segments; L'Oréal's '2023 Annual Report' from February 2024 noted that its Dermatological Beauty Division attained like-for-like sales growth of 28.4%. Reinforcing this retail momentum, Ulta Beauty's 'Fourth Quarter and Fiscal 2023 Results' in March 2024 revealed a 9.8% increase in annual net sales to $11.2 billion, indicating sustained consumer spending on personal care staples.

Market Challenges

The Global Facial Mist Market encounters significant obstacles due to the prevailing consumer view that these products are discretionary, non-essential items. In contrast to foundational skincare necessities like moisturizers or cleansers, facial mists are frequently categorized as luxury supplements designed for fleeting refreshment. This perception generates distinct price sensitivity, especially when buyers confront reduced disposable income or inflationary strains. During such economic conditions, consumers strictly audit their grooming expenditures, often opting to streamline routines by maintaining only high-efficacy basics while removing supplementary steps; consequently, facial mists are among the first items eliminated from shopping baskets, resulting in volume reductions even if consumer interest theoretically persists.

This pattern of financial prudence regarding physical beauty products is supported by recent industry performance data, which indicates that spending on goods is trailing behind other sectors. As the cost of living constrains purchasing power, the growth of tangible product sales has been noticeably curbed. According to the British Beauty Council, the personal care goods sector saw only a modest real-term growth of 3% in 2024 after adjusting for inflation, signaling a stagnation in purchase volumes. This restrained growth highlights the challenge manufacturers face in persuading budget-conscious consumers to allocate resources to discretionary goods like facial mists when their overall ability to buy physical items is limited.

Market Trends

The widespread implementation of refillable and sustainable packaging systems is fundamentally transforming production norms within the facial mist industry. Driven by tightening regulatory frameworks and consumer expectations for circularity, manufacturers are advancing beyond basic recycling to adopt aluminum formats and dedicated refill pods that decrease single-use plastic waste. This operational evolution is measurable; according to an article by Packaging Europe in April 2025 titled 'Where L'Oréal stands after missing sustainable packaging goals for 2025', the conglomerate disclosed that despite ambitious targets, only 49% of its packaging portfolio was recyclable, reusable, or refillable, highlighting the substantial industrial exertion needed to satisfy these emerging ecological benchmarks.

Simultaneously, the incorporation of microbiome-friendly and probiotic ingredients is establishing a new functional category focused on balancing the bacterial ecosystem rather than solely providing hydration. Distinct from traditional mists that concentrate on moisture retention, these sophisticated formulations employ postbiotics and live active cultures to actively strengthen the skin's natural flora against dysbiosis. This growing consumer emphasis on biological skin health is reflected in search trends; according to BeautyMatter's September 2025 article 'Beautiful Bacteria: Are We on the Cusp of Microbiome Mainstreaming?', global interest has escalated, with average monthly Google searches for 'microbiome' reaching 110,000 between August 2024 and July 2025.
